Fintech, Blockchain and AI Conference at UT Dallas


RICHARDSON, Texas, March 8, 2018 /PRNewswire/ -- Don Tapscott, a global leader in spotting digital innovation's impact on huge segments of the worldwide economy — including finance and cryptocurrency — will headline the Emerging Technologies Summit at The University of Texas at Dallas. The summit, April 18-19 on the UT Dallas campus, will include experts in artificial intelligence, fintech, blockchain and distributed ledger technologies.

Tapscott, who will speak April 18, has tracked digital influence and impact for decades, going back to the 1980s. His most recent book, written with his son, Alex Tapscott, is The Blockchain Revolution: How the Technology Behind Bitcoin is Changing Money, Business, and the World (New York: Penguin Books, 2016). His TEDTalk, "How the blockchain is changing money and business," has more than 2.8 million views on YouTube.

"Today's thriving economies rely heavily on fintech — financial technology — yet few users understand its importance to daily transactions, such as online and mobile banking, and its connection to blockchain," says Steve Guengerich, executive director of the UT Dallas Institute for Innovation and Entrepreneurship and an associate professor at the Naveen Jindal School of Management. "The goal of the summit is to bring together the pioneers in these areas, to build the ecosystem in the greater Dallas region and to enable the next generation's new ventures."

Bryan Chambers, director of UT Dallas' Blackstone LaunchPad, says corporate sponsorship permits this event to include top thought leaders. "Other key sponsors and partners include Nano Global Corp., Texas Capital Bank, Tech Titans, Dallas TiE, Capital Factory and the Dallas Entrepreneur Center."


A summit highlight, Chambers says, is a showcase of startups and entrepreneurial companies that will demonstrate their use and the impact of technologies that leverage artificial intelligence, blockchain, distributed ledger technologies and "internet of things"/mobility. Showcase startups will include Swirlds (inventor of Hashgraph), AmplifAI, Parkhub and RoboKind.

The UT Dallas Naveen Jindal School of Management, Erik Jonsson School of Engineering and Computer Science and Institute for Innovation and Entrepreneurship also are sponsoring the summit.
